Refit analysis ·10 of the top skills overlap between Cutters and Trimmers, Hand and Cutting and Slicing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ders — Monitoring, Reading Comprehension, Critical Thinking, Active Listening, so that experience transfers directly. The main gaps to close are few. Median pay moves from $38,800 to $45,700 (+18%).
